Installing A Ceiling Light Fixture
Installing a ceiling light fixture is a relatively simple task that can be completed in a few hours. However, it is important to follow the instructions carefully to ensure that the fixture is installed safely and correctly.
Before you begin, you should gather the following tools and materials:
- A new ceiling light fixture
- A screwdriver
- A wire cutter
- A wire stripper
- Electrical tape
- A ladder
Once you have gathered your tools and materials, you can begin the installation process.
Step 1: Turn off the power
The first step is to turn off the power to the circuit that powers the light fixture. You can do this by flipping the circuit breaker or removing the fuse that corresponds to the circuit.
Step 2: Remove the old light fixture
Once the power is turned off, you can remove the old light fixture. To do this, simply unscrew the screws that hold the fixture in place and carefully lower it from the ceiling.
Step 3: Connect the wires
Once the old light fixture is removed, you need to connect the wires from the new fixture to the wires in the ceiling. To do this, use the wire strippers to remove about 1/2 inch of insulation from the ends of the wires. Then, twist the exposed wires together and secure them with electrical tape.
Step 4: Mount the new light fixture
Once the wires are connected, you can mount the new light fixture to the ceiling. To do this, simply line up the mounting holes on the fixture with the holes in the ceiling and insert the screws. Tighten the screws until the fixture is securely in place.
Step 5: Turn on the power
Once the light fixture is mounted, you can turn on the power to the circuit. To do this, simply flip the circuit breaker back on or insert the fuse that you removed.
Step 6: Test the light fixture
Once the power is turned on, you should test the light fixture to make sure that it is working properly. To do this, simply turn on the light switch and make sure that the light comes on.
If the light fixture is not working properly, check the following:
- Make sure that the wires are connected properly.
- Make sure that the light bulb is properly installed.
- Make sure that the light switch is turned on.
If you have checked all of these things and the light fixture is still not working, you may need to call an electrician for assistance.
